Was that the new emaxx or the old one? Does the free shocks go with the new emaxx? Thinking of getting the new emaxx
Owned an emaxx 2 years ago and only sold it when i went on road. by far, it was the best off road for me for bashing and light racing. also had a Losi XXTCR and LosiXXX4 at that time and the emaxx held up well. just changed to aluminum bulkheads, RPM arms and CVDs. No experience with MLST but can't go wrong with the emaxx. use good batts. good experience with GP, Orion
